Output 5ae4e1457489caee065be786f8784ea176da558a67bdaaabddec7ae4a6f347d0:0

value
558659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af045dc76a84a4f7422308fba0efcd3f11b8e106 OP_EQUAL
address
3HeRQVTyaD9w5WpfobdPvtRAkmkqBp97RQ
transaction
5ae4e1457489caee065be786f8784ea176da558a67bdaaabddec7ae4a6f347d0
confirmations
403355
spent
true